After being processed in a tempering furnace, the original glass will exhibit pitting, which is actually a manifestation of the appearance quality defect of tempered glass. Generally, appearance quality defects are related to the production operation of the tempering furnace and the control of various parameters. Below, we will analyze the reasons and solutions for the occurrence of pitting in the glass tempering process.

1. The reasons for the occurrence of pitting during the glass tempering process

1.1. Glass surface impurities:

There is moisture-proof powder sticking to the glass due to moisture on the original glass sheet, or there are other impurities on the glass surface that have not been cleaned before tempering.

1.2. Insulation cotton peeling off:

The heating part of the tempering furnace is equipped with insulation cotton on the furnace. The insulation cotton, which has been used for a long time or has shed tissue due to high-temperature oil, falls onto the glass during the fiberglass protection process and is fixed on the glass surface after heating, forming pitting points.

1.3. Incomplete cleaning:

The glass is not cleaned after grinding, and during long-term storage, the remaining glass powder on the glass dries and remains on the original glass sheet, which is fixed on the glass surface by the heating section at high temperature and forms pitting.

1.4. Ceramic roller dirt:

If the roller conveyor of the tempering furnace is not regularly cleaned, during the early operation process, due to incomplete cleaning after the blast furnace, the melted glass fragments will be heated out of the furnace again with the new glass, forming pitting on the glass.

1.5. More sulfur dioxide is introduced:

We usually use the introduction of sulfur dioxide to clean the dirt on the roller conveyor. However, due to the strong corrosiveness of sulfur dioxide, excessive introduction will corrode the surface of the roller conveyor and leave spots, leaving spots when tempered glass passes through.

1.6. Long heating time:

Glass heated for too long in a tempering furnace can also easily show pitting or other external damage on the surface.

2. Solution to the occurrence of pitting during glass tempering process

2.1. Dense pitting

Dense pitting is usually more concentrated, which can be solved by adjusting the heating time and temperature of the equipment due to long heating times or high temperatures in the tempering furnace. The specific temperature and heating time adjustment can be determined based on the parameters of the batch of glass with better tempering effect.

2.2. Dispersed pitting

Scattered pitting is usually distributed in a star pattern, not concentrated and irregular. This situation is mostly caused by the unclean surface or raceway of the glass tempering furnace. Regular cleaning and maintenance work should be completed for the glass tempering furnace.

2.3. Occasional numbness

If it doesn't happen every time, just after introducing sulfur dioxide and ensuring that the roller and countertop are clean, it may be because too much sulfur dioxide is introduced, causing corrosion to the roller and affecting the flatness of the glass surface, forming spots. At this time, the roller can be repaired or replaced according to the situation. In addition, regular maintenance should be carried out on the glass tempering furnace, insulation cotton, and roller conveyor. If any damage is found, it should be replaced in a timely manner. At the same time, the cleanliness of the original glass sheet should be controlled to ensure the cleanliness before entering the furnace.
